			Gandalf quotes the inscription at the Council of Elrond (The Fellowship of the Ring, Book II, chapter II). Although written using an ancient Elvish script, it is indeed in the Black Speech of Mordor. In that language it reads: Ash nazg durbatulûk, ash nazg gimbatul, ash nazg thrakatulûk agh burzum-ishi krimpatul.
